Nexperia and Tata to produce chips at new Gujarat and Assam fabs

Nexperia and Tata Electronics announced a strategic partnership to manufacture and package Nexperia semiconductor products in India, combining wafer fabrication, assembly and testing, technology development, and ecosystem-building efforts. The companies plan to produce Nexperia’s MOSFET portfolio at Tata’s planned 300mm fab in Dholera, Gujarat, and assemble and test discrete chips at Tata’s facility in Jagiroad, Assam. The agreement is intended to expand India’s semiconductor capabilities, diversify production, and strengthen supply-chain resilience, with no financial terms disclosed. The partnership comes as India accelerates its semiconductor program, which officials say has attracted $11 billion to $12 billion in prospective investment, while Nexperia seeks to reduce vulnerabilities linked to its continuing separation from Chinese parent Wingtech.
